It's become clear we need to sometimes deal with values <0 or >1.
I'm not yet convinced we care about NaN or +-inf.
We had some fairly clever tricks and optimizations here for NEON
and SSE. I've thrown them out in favor of a single implementation.
If we find the specializations mattered, we can certainly figure out
how to extend them to this new range/domain.
This happens to add a vectorized float -> half for ARMv7, which was
missing from the _01 version. (The SSE strategy was not portable to
platforms that flush denorm floats to zero.)
I've tested the full float range for FloatToHalf on my desktop and a 5x.

If we make sure all SkOpts functions are static, we can give the namespaces any
name we like. This lets us drop the sk_ prefix and give a real indication of
the default SIMD instruction set rather than just saying sk_default.
Both of these changes help debugger, profiler, and crash report readability.
Perhaps more importantly, keeping these functions static helps prevent
accidentally linking in unused versions of functions, as you see here with
sk_avx::srcover_srgb_srgb().
This requires we update SkBlend_opts tests and benches to call SkOpts functions
through SkOpts rather than declaring the methods externally. In practice this
drops testing of the SSE2 version on machines with SSE4. If we still really
need to test/bench the compile time best SIMD level version of this method
against the runtime detected best, we can include SkBlend_opts.h into the tests
or benches directly, similar to what we do for the trivial, brute-force, or best
non-SIMD versions.

Now that there may be multiple font managers in a process the typeface
ids must be unique across all typefaces, not just unique within a font
manager. If two typefaces have the same id there will be issues in the
glyph cache. All existing font managers were already doing this by
calling SkFontCache::NewFontID, so centralize this in SkTypeface.

SkMatrix::scale and ::rotate take a point around which to scale or rotate.
Canvas lacks these helpers, so the code to rotate a canvas around a
point has been duplicated many times. Factor all of these
implementations into SkCanvas::rotate.

This removes the code paths where we make SkCpu::Supports() calls
from within a tight loop. It keeps code paths using SkCpu::Supports()
to choose entire routines from src/opts/.
We can't rely on these hyper-local checks to be hoisted up reliably enough.
It worked pretty well with the first couple platforms we tried (e.g. Clang
on Linux/Mac) but we can't gaurantee it works everywhere.
Further, I'm not able to actually do anything fancy with those tests
outside of x86... I've not found a way to get, say, NEON+F16 conversion
code embedded into ordinary NEON code outside writing then entire function
in external assembly.
This whole idea becomes less important now that we've got a way to chain
separate function calls together efficiently. We can now, e.g., use an
AVX+F16C method to load some pixels, then chain that into an ordinary AVX
method to color filter them.

Check failed in GPUs with low-precision floats since 0.9999 was too small a difference from 1 to be detected by a 16-bit float comparison. Changed it to 0.999 which fixed the issue and results in indistinguishable correct behavior.

If the transform used to compute the res scale has both 0 scale and skew,
then it will currently compute a 0 res scale. This causes getFillPath
to trigger an assertion while using SkStroke since that can't handle
a 0 res scale.
